Illusione 88 Cigar Review
http://cigarobsession.com/wp-content...one88_0001.jpg
This 5×52 robusto sized stick offered a very oily, smooth firm wrapper with a nice sweet floral aroma. Burn was very good all the way down, holding the ash to each third. Draw was slightly on the loose side with perfect resistance. The first third brought flavors of slightly sweet leather, a touch of cocoa and coffee with a mildly spicy finish that built up heat as it went along. The 2nd third transitioned to a nice dry coffee, still with a nice oil on the mouth and a touch of earthiness. The last third smoothed out just a bit and dropped the spice, adding a longer finish of oily coffee. Total burn time just past the band was 1:10. Overall a medium-full body with very rich flavors.
